FLORENCE, S.C. – Francis Marion forced 21 turnovers and converted those into 32 points while also shooting nearly 44-percent from the field to secure a 80-58 victory over the UNC Pembroke women's basketball team on Monday evening at the University Smith Center.
The setback for the Braves (3-12, 3-11 PBC) marks the sixth straight loss to the Patriots in Florence, S.C. The Patriots (2-11, 2-9 PBC) have now won the last three meetings against the Braves.

HOW IT HAPPENED |
1ST QUARTER |
Gabby Smith's layup three minutes into action cut the deficit for UNC Pembroke back to 7-4. Francis Marion used a 6-0 scoring surge to push its lead out to 13-4, before two made free throws from Aaliyah Bell broke the silence for UNCP with 2:45 left in the quarter. The hosts shot 42-percent in the stanza and held a 20-10 lead heading into the second quarter. |
2ND QUARTER |
Jasmine Stanley's jumper in the paint put the Patriots in front 29-14 halfway through the period. The Braves responded with back-to-back jumpers from Naomi Gilbert and Courtney Smith to trim the deficit back to 29-18 at the two-minute mark. Kelci Adams drained a three with 30 seconds left followed by a layup from Alcenia Purnell as the clock expired to send the teams to the locker rooms with Francis Marion holding a 33-23 advantage. |
3RD QUARTER |
Alcenia Purnell's trey 4:15 minutes into the half cut the deficit for the UNCP back to 43-31. Francis Marion responded with two made free throws and a three of their own to push the lead back out to 48-31. The hosts connected on 7-for-10 attempts from the charity stripe and held a hefty 57-37 lead heading into the final quarter. |
4TH QUARTER |
Kelly Luck's old-fashioned three-point play with 3:20 whittled the deficit back to 68-50 for the Braves. The Patriots took their largest lead of the night 77-50, with a running layup from Ravyn Madaris with 1:37 remaining to secure the outcome. |

INSIDE THE BOX SCORE |
+ Gabby Smith scored a team-high 19 points and pulled down eight rebounds in 20 minutes of action. Smith scored in double-figures on 11 different occasions.
+ Aaliyah Bell scored a career-high 11 points highlighted by a 3-for-3 clip from the perimeter.
+ Alcenia Purnell added 10 points and three assists. Purnell also had one steal. |
|
NOTABLES |
+ The Black & Gold connected on 6-for-16 (37%) of shots from the 3-point line. Francis Marion was limted to 32-percent from beyond the arc, but attempted 15 more shots from deep than UNCP.
+ Francis Marion forced 21 UNC Pembroke turnovers and converted those into 32 points.
+ The Braves shot better than 40-percent in the final two quarters of action. |
